Job Description The role and responsibilities
Leadership and management
Support and implement the vision, ethos, and strategic priorities of the school
Deputise For The Head Of Primary As Required
Line manage Assistant Heads and MLT, ensuring consistency in curriculum delivery, teaching quality, and use of data
Contribute to, implement, and evaluate the School Development Plan
Lead and support self-evaluation processes including departmental reviews, SEFs, and inspection preparation
Ensure policies are consistently translated into effective practice
Promote inclusive practice and high expectations across all departments
Develop leadership capacity through coaching, mentoring, and professional development
Act as a proactive and effective member of the Senior Leadership Team
Teaching and learning responsibilityLead the implementation of the school’s Teaching & Learning framework (e.g. TLAG)
Ensure high-quality, consistent teaching across all subjects
Lead quality assurance activities including : learning walks, book looks, lesson observations
Work with Assistant Heads and MLT to improve pedagogy, differentiation, and challenge
Promote cross-curricular approaches and innovation in teaching
Drive continuous improvement in teaching standards (Good > Very Good > Outstanding)
Model outstanding classroom practice
Monitoring and assessmentLead Primary data and assessment systems, ensuring accuracy, consistency, and impact
Oversee internal and external assessment processes (e.g. GL, CAT4, NGRT where applicable)
Ensure data is used effectively to inform planning, intervention, and target setting
Monitor student progress and attainment across departments
Lead Raising Attainment Plans (RAPs) and intervention strategies
Standardise assessment practices across departments
Ensure timely and accurate reporting to students and parents
Staff developmentAct as a reviewer within the school’s appraisal process
Identify training needs and support professional development across Primary
Coach and mentor Assistant Heads, MLT and teaching staff
Promote collaboration, teamwork, and continuous improvement
Ensure staff remain up to date with current educational developments
Parental EngagementLead Primary parental engagement systems, including consultation evenings and communication protocols
Ensure timely, transparent, and effective communication with parents
Promote strong partnerships between school and home
Monitor and improve parental engagement and satisfaction
Personal And Professional ResponsibilitiesAct as a role model for high standards of professionalism, teaching, and leadership
Initiate and lead change to improve standards and outcomes
Maintain up-to-date knowledge of educational best practice
Support the school’s values and contribute to the wider life of the school
Promote positive relationships with students, staff, and parents
